Hyde Street is an American horror comic book series written by Geoff Johns and illustrated by Ivan Reis. It is published by Image Comics through the creator-owned company Ghost Machine. The series began publication on October 2, 2024.[1]

The series follows the supernatural location known as Hyde Street (based on the city of the same name in San Francisco), a cursed dimension that can appear in different towns and cities. Its recurring characters include Mr. X-Ray, Pranky, Miss Goodbody, Doctor Ego, the Matinee Monster, and the Scorekeeper.[2]

Publication history

Hyde Street was launched as one of Ghost Machine's horror titles. The first issue was released by Image Comics on October 2, 2024.[1] The main creative team consists of writer Geoff Johns, artist Ivan Reis, inker Danny Miki, colorist Brad Anderson, and letterer Rob Leigh.[2]

The series was preceded by material in Ghost Machine #1, the company's introductory one-shot, and was followed by related titles including It Happened on Hyde Street: Devour and Sisterhood: A Hyde Street Story.[1] In March 2025, Image Comics announced that Hyde Street #3 and #4 had sold out at the distributor level and would receive second printings.[3]

Premise

The series is structured around Hyde Street, a mysterious and dangerous place where morally corrupt people may be trapped or punished. The stories use recurring supernatural hosts and residents, including Mr. X-Ray and Pranky, while individual issues focus on different characters and moral consequences.[4]

It Happened on Hyde Street: Devour

It Happened on Hyde Street: Devour is a one-shot written by Maytal Zchut and illustrated by Leila Leiz. It was released on October 30, 2024.[1]

Sisterhood: A Hyde Street Story

Sisterhood: A Hyde Street Story is a five-issue limited series written by Maytal Zchut and illustrated by Leila Leiz. The first issue was released on July 2, 2025.[5]

Reception

Mariano Abrach of Zona Negativa described Hyde Street as a horror anthology with a connecting setting and compared its structure to works such as Tales from the Crypt and The Twilight Zone.[4] Reviewing Hyde Street #5 for AIPT, Crooker praised the issue's focus on Miss Goodbody and described it as a critique of 1980s diet culture.[6]
